This topic could be blogged about in a million different ways, but here are my thoughts today on prayer. Whenever this subject comes up in conversation or we're challenged to make this more of a priority, lot's of questions are asked:

Is God really listening? Should I pray only about serious issues? What should I talk to Him about? etc...

I listened to a Q&A session with Beth Moore, and one of the questions was,
"Why should we pray if God already makes up His mind?"

I loved her insight and answer to this. Here it is:

Philippians 4:6-"Don't be anxious about anything, but in everything by prayer and petition with Thanksgiving present your requests to God."

"Pray about everything. The word of God says everything can be affected by prayer. The enemy wants you to think prayer is ineffective. He would rather you study the word and disconnect in your relational area of prayer. He would rather me get a headful of knowledge and not a powerful prayer life. He wants me to disconnect with prayer because as a result, so much power will come through my life. He wants me to think praying will not make a difference.

James 5:17- "The prayers of the righteous are effectual"
John 11:41-42 Jesus always prayed as one who knew His father was listening.

How differently would we pray if we knew He was right there?"

She challenged us to start our morning prayer by saying, "God I know you hear me..."

Well I accepted the challenge and found out it does make a difference. Knowing that God is there with me and listening, I become less guarded and more vulnerable. I get to know Him more. I'm learning to talk to Him not only about the important things, but the trivial ones too. It's much easier to have a good prayer life during hard and desperate times. However, God desires a constant, daily relationship with Him. No matter the situation or season of life, good, bad or mundane. His love is unconditional and He delights in us.

So in the immortal words of MC Hammer, "We got to pray just to make it today." Why? Because it's spending time with Jesus. Time talking to Him and drawing closer to His heart. We will become more like Him, and that makes for a better day all around.
